Develop program for robot welder to generate it’s own weld and movement code based on a 3D CAD model with some weld symbology input. Similar to a CNC mill, or laser cutter, the welder would be able to generate travel paths and weld on/off inputs based on the 3D info of the design.

Project Objectives:

  • Identify joints requiring welding from the 3D CAD part
  • “See” the part in real time on the welding table
  • Accept manual input on weld size and weld type from operator
  • Perform accurate weld on part for production line
